The Weakness in Me

BY Susan Baba

There is a mountain of evidence to condemn you
The jury has spoken
The judge has ruled
But I, your executioner and victim in one
When I am faced with the choice between loneliness and retribution
Would choose to pardon you
Again and again
If only to have something to hold on to tonight

Memory
BY Susan Baba

Tell me the places you’ve been.
I want to write your memories on my heart too.
I want to see that starry and faraway look
And travel to that place with you.

The first sunset –
You were so tiny beside the vastness of that Arabian coast
But you never would have known it from the power in your voice.
You were not scared.
You stared down the sun
Made it quiver in its boots
And, when you were finished,
You coaxed the moon out to play with the tapping of two sticks.
Your baby sister did not understand
But I promise I will.

Take us back there.

To the first day you learned that you were invincible –
You swung higher and higher
Everything below looking liked patchwork and pebbles
You leaned forward,
Let go,
And jumped regally off of the swing set.
No cape, but you were just as majestic.
No parents and their cautious hands below to catch you
Just you and air and courage.

Take us back to that place.

Where the timbre of her voice rang even in your dreams
She was a flawless first love.
Her hair smelled like Magnolia blossoms and her smile made it all make sense.
You wanted to kiss her forever
But she turned her face too quickly
Took a step away from you and never looked back again.
Tell me how it pained you to let her walk away, without so much as “I love you” or “goodbye.”
How you vowed to keep walking too,
In the path of your own choosing, this time.
You must have thought the world was ending then.

So, tell me how it ended.
How many “hallelujahs” it took to lead you back to yourself and onto my doorstep.
I want to know.

You are a man.
A brave and collected soul.
You come to me worthy of much admiration
But, I know your path was not always straight
That you fought your way through thick forests
That made you look around for your father’s arms
Let's travel back there.
Feel the intensity of those things already past.
When you go back to those memories,
Take me with you.

The Eye of Soul
BY Oliver O. Mbamara

I judge you not by what you wear,
Whether your garment is of rag or riches,
Or your skin is of a color white or black,
Whether you wear some gold or trinkets,
Or decorate yourself with stones and diamonds,
I see you with the eye of Soul.

I know you, for who you are inside of you,
Not for your smiles, for smiles could be false,
Not for your looks, for looks could deceive,
Not for your appearance, for that won't last,
And not for your clothes, for that only covers.
I see you with the eye of Soul.

I am a friend to that you inside of you,
Indifferent to your dose of limitations,
Forgiving to your human flaws of character
Unyielding to rumors and gossips about you
For the eye within sees even more,
I see you with the eye of Soul.
